Comprehending the Abdominoplasty Treatment



An abdominoplasty, or abdominoplasty, is a prominent cosmetic operation created to flatten your tummy by eliminating excess skin and fat. During the procedure, your surgeon makes a horizontal incision throughout your reduced abdomen, permitting them to gain access to and tighten up the underlying muscular tissues. They'll likewise remove any type of sagging skin, leading to a smoother, firmer look.




 


You'll usually receive general anesthetic, making particular you're comfortable throughout the surgical procedure. The procedure can take several hours, depending on your certain needs. Later, you'll have drains pipes put to help eliminate fluid accumulation and warranty appropriate healing.


Expect some swelling and discomfort as you recover, yet your surgeon will give discomfort monitoring options. It's vital to adhere to post-operative care guidelines closely to attain the most effective outcomes. You'll likely observe a significant modification in your body shape, boosting your confidence and enhancing your general look.




Pre-Surgery Preparations



Before your abdominoplasty surgery, it's important to take several primary steps to guarantee a smooth experience. Start by setting up a detailed consultation with your specialist. Discuss your medical background, any type of medicines you're taking, and your expectations for the treatment.


You'll likely need to quit cigarette smoking and prevent certain medications like pain killers and anti-inflammatory medications to decrease the risk of problems. It's additionally vital to keep a healthy and balanced diet and stay hydrated in the weeks leading up to your surgical procedure.


Prepare your healing area in your home by stockpiling on products like comfy clothing, painkiller, and easy-to-eat meals. Schedule somebody to assist you during the first couple of days post-surgery, as movement will be restricted. Follow your doctor's details instructions very closely to make certain you're in the best shape feasible for your stomach tuck and recovery.

Recovery Timeline and Assumptions



Healing from abdominoplasty surgical treatment generally unravels over a number of weeks, with each phase providing distinct assumptions and turning points. In the initial week, you'll focus on rest and start mild motions to aid flow. Do not be stunned if you really feel tightness or swelling; this is typical as your body starts recovery.


By week two, you can gradually enhance your task level, but listen to your body. You may still require help with day-to-day jobs, as flexibility can be limited. Around the 3rd week, lots of clients return to light job and day-to-day regimens, though exhausting tasks need to still be stayed clear of.


After about 4 to 6 weeks, you'll likely observe substantial enhancements in your flexibility and comfort. Full healing can take several months, so be person as your body readjusts. Keep in mind to follow your surgeon's standards to assure a smooth healing and optimal outcomes.

Regularly Asked Questions



Will I Have Visible Scars After My Abdominoplasty?



Yes, you'll likely have visible marks after your belly tuck. Nevertheless, the specialist will certainly position lacerations purposefully to minimize their appearance. With time, these scars may browse around this site discolor and become less noticeable with appropriate treatment.

Can I Have Children After an Abdominoplasty?



Yes, you can have youngsters after an abdominoplasty. However, it's typically advised to wait until you're done having kids. Pregnancy can stretch your abdominal skin once again, potentially impacting your surgical results.




Just How Much Weight Can I Lose From a Tummy Put?



You can generally shed around 5 to 10 extra pounds from an abdominoplasty, relying on individual scenarios. It's not a weight-loss procedure; it primarily concentrates on tightening and contouring your abdominal area.




Are There Any Kind Of Age Constraints for Abdominoplasty Surgical Treatment?



There aren't rigorous age constraints for abdominoplasty surgical procedure, yet many doctors choose people to be a minimum of 18. Your general health and wellness and skin elasticity play a bigger role in determining your qualification.




Will Insurance Cover My Tummy Tuck Procedure?



Insurance coverage generally does not cover abdominoplasty procedures considering that they're frequently thought about cosmetic. However, if you have medical reasons, like considerable weight reduction or stomach concerns, it's worth discussing with your supplier to discover your choices.
